> I'm trying to connect to a UV-5R using a USB cable that was bought some
> time (maybe 5-10 years) ago, using chirpw on ubuntu 16.04.
>
> The tty port is found when I plug it in:
> $ dmesg | grep tty
> [ 7527.188154] usb 1-2: pl2303 converter now attached to ttyUSB0
> [ 7548.490452] pl2303 ttyUSB0: pl2303 converter now disconnected from
> ttyUSB0
>
> $ la /dev/ttyU*
> crw-rw---- 1 root dialout 188, 0 Feb 17 13:49 /dev/ttyUSB0
>
> When I start chirpw and try to download from radio, the error is not
> consistent, it depends on whether I've tried it before or not. Sometimes I
> get the error:
> [Errno 16] could not open port /dev/ttyUSB0:
> [Errno 16] Device or resource busy: '/dev/ttyUSB0'
>
> and /dev/ttyUSB0 disappears.
>
> Another time after I unplugged and replugged the USB cable and restarted
> chirpw, /dev/ttyUSB0 reappears and when I try to download from radio I get:
> [Errno 5] could not open port /dev/ttyUSB0:
> [Errno 5] Input/output error: '/dev/ttyUSB0'
>
> Any advice on how to troubleshoot this?
